If so, you’ll need to supplement with milk you purchase out of your vet and with a dropper or a bottle for puppies. Regardless, once your puppy is weaned, it will be time to begin with stable foods. Importantly, in relation to sustaining your puppy’s weight, avoid giving things like bones, table scraps, and different treats that aren’t nutrient rich. Your rapidly rising puppy needs these meals to have a wholesome maturity. You can present that by following a feeding schedule with the right amount of high-quality pet meals. At this stage, you will start to reduce your puppy’s feedings by one, so if you gave your pet 4 feedings, you will cut back to a few.

These foods comprise more calories, protein, and calcium, essential in your puppy’s progress and improvement. If you may be training your puppy using treats, you will want to factor that into your feeding plan when it comes to the amount of food you give your pet. At 12 to thirteen weeks, small breed puppies sometimes should be off the milk replacer and eating only dry food. At 9 to 10 weeks, giant breed puppies typically must be off the milk replacer and consuming dry food. Consult your veterinarian and different sources during major developmental phases, which occur every few months in your puppy’s first 12 months, to guarantee that your puppy is getting the healthy start he deserves. Your puppy’s health is the aim of following a feeding program; you can monitor your puppy’s weight by weighing yourself and then maintain him if you weigh your self. Subtract the difference to acquire your puppy’s weight.

Use that info to discover out how much to feed him. These are common pointers, so check with the bag of food that you are using to feed your puppy, as most have feeding charts on the label. When it comes time to transition your puppy to grownup pet food, do so steadily over the course of a few days to avoid upsetting your maturing pet’s stomach. As when selecting a puppy meals, it’s really helpful that you just consult your veterinarian to find a high-quality meals product. The aim of correctly feeding a puppy is to avoid extra weight as that can create health issues.
